The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in England with a requirement for Java sk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Java over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 35 18 15
Rank change year-on-year -17 -3 -1
Permanent jobs citing Java 4,508 9,655 18,443
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 5.32% 10.36% 14.11%
As % of the Programming Languages category 16.40% 23.79% 26.48%
Number of salaries quoted 3,370 5,679 8,923
10th Percentile £39,000 £46,250 £42,500
25th Percentile £52,500 £57,500 £52,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£72,500 £80,000 £72,500
Median % change year-on-year -9.38% +10.34% +11.54%
75th Percentile £97,500 £105,000 £95,000
90th Percentile £130,000 £130,000 £116,000
UK median annual salary £70,000 £77,500 £70,000
% change year-on-year -9.68% +10.71% +7.69%
